Heavy Duty Connectors - Accessories

1. Overview

Heavy Duty Connectors (HDC) and accessories are industrial-grade electrical components designed to establish secure and reliable connections in harsh environments. They support high current, voltage, and mechanical stress tolerance, enabling safe power/data transmission in critical systems. These connectors are essential in modern infrastructure, including renewable energy systems, smart grids, and industrial automation, where failure prevention and operational continuity are paramount.

3. Structure and Components

A typical HDC assembly comprises:
- Housing: Thermoplastic (PA66) or die-cast metal (aluminum alloy) with anti-UV treatment
- Contact System: Silver-plated copper alloy contacts with self-cleaning design
- Insulation: High-temperature resistant PA or PPS materials (180 C rating)
- Retention Mechanism: Threaded, bayonet, or push-pull locking systems
- Sealing: EPDM rubber gaskets for IP67 protection

4. Key Technical Specifications

ParameterImportance
Rated Current (16-2000A)Determines power transmission capacity
Dielectric Withstanding Voltage (1000-8000V)Ensures electrical safety under overvoltage
Contact Resistance ( 0.5m )Minimizes energy loss and thermal rise
Mechanical Durability (5000-20000 mating cycles)Long-term reliability indicator
Operating Temperature (-40 C to +150 C)Environmental adaptability
Vibration Resistance (10G-50G)Critical for mobile/transport applications

5. Application Fields

Key industries include:
- Energy: Solar inverters, offshore wind turbines
- Transportation: Electric vehicle charging stations, locomotive systems
- Manufacturing: CNC machines, automated guided vehicles (AGVs)
- Infrastructure: Smart grid switchgear, emergency power systems
- Special Cases: Explosion-proof connectors for petrochemical plants

7. Selection Recommendations

Key considerations:
1. Calculate maximum current/voltage with 20% safety margin
2. Match IP rating to environmental conditions (e.g., IP67 for outdoor use)
3. Consider mating cycle requirements for maintenance frequency
4. Verify material compatibility for chemical exposure
5. Check standard certifications (IEC 61984, UL 1977)
Case Example: For offshore wind turbine generator connection: Select IP68-rated connector with 1500V insulation and salt spray resistance >1000h.

8. Industry Trends

Emerging trends include:
- Miniaturization with increased power density (e.g., 30% size reduction by 2025)
- Integrated smart sensors for predictive maintenance
- Adoption of composite materials for weight reduction (-40% vs. metal)
- Development of hydrogen-compatible connectors for fuel cell systems
- Growth in hybrid connectors combining power, data, and fluid transmission
